Transaction 44c5632647fd13f4d35eeeb233e4149ed0f7366577fdd9b5728e3368079c5714

1 Input
2 Outputs
  • 44c5632647fd13f4d35eeeb233e4149ed0f7366577fdd9b5728e3368079c5714:0
  • value  884479
    address  3CnVJ8QHLM2jhXAtW8J3HKLDedp2khiwWY
  • 44c5632647fd13f4d35eeeb233e4149ed0f7366577fdd9b5728e3368079c5714:1
  • value  42976887
    address  1LfBpkaSPEQd7qVSCFTAi4QQYpBiKzpN62